## Artifact Signing: Duskline Admin Dashboard

The dark-mode theme bundle for the Harrowfield admin dashboard ships as a signed artifact, separate from the main app. On-call engineers should verify the bundle signature before any hotfix deploy, because an unsigned theme silently falls back to light mode and pages the visual-regression alert. Verification uses the `duskline-verify` tool on the bastion host. For convenience during incidents, the current public verification key is reproduced below.

rollout seal: bky4_x7Gc

Heads-up for new folks: our video transcoding farm, Gristmill, is partly run by an outside vendor, Quenchworks. They handle the GPU nodes; we own the job scheduler. If a vendor node goes sideways, don't poke it yourself — file a ticket and tag the vendor queue. For contract questions or escalations, reach vendor management at the address below.

escalation mailbox, yafog-kafof: eliok@xolmarcloud.local

14:22 — Ordering stopped for Millbrook Bakery storefront. Root cause: the order-cutoff rule in Ovenlight compared local time to UTC midnight, rejecting all same-day orders after 19:00. Fix shipped via hotfix branch, verified in staging at 15:05, promoted at 15:20. Release manager sign-off required against the build identified below.

trace token, fafog-kageg: htk4_98e6

**Action Item 4 — Partition `event_ledger` by month**

Owner: Tomas. Deadline: end of sprint 42.

Root cause traced to unbounded table growth in `event_ledger`; full scans blew query budgets during the Larkfield incident. Fix: convert to monthly range partitions, backfill last 18 months, add automated partition creation job. Reviewers: check that the migration is idempotent and that the drop-old-partition cron respects the 13-month retention rule. Design doc with schema diffs and rollout plan is on the internal page.

dashboard of bahaf-tageg = https://jira.zemvarlabs.internal/projects/projects/browse/projects